Technical Memorandum
To: Justin Femrite, PE, City of Elk River City Engineer
From: Bryant Ficek, P.E., P.T.O.E.
Date: July 22, 2016
Re: Traffic Operations Study Addendum – Line Avenue Corridor
A study of the Line Avenue corridor, dated June 15, 2016, examined the traffic implications of
modifications to that corridor between the intersection with Main Street/181st Avenue and Twin Lakes
Road. This study and its results were presented to the City Council and discussed most recently at a
workshop meeting on July 18, 2016. The direction of the Council from that meeting was to disconnect Line
Avenue between its intersections with 3rd Street and with 5th Street. As noted in the June 15, 2016 report,
the left turn movement on Line Avenue at the Twin Lakes Road intersection is expected to have
unacceptable traffic operations under this scenario. The purpose of this memorandum is to examine the
Line Avenue/Twin Lakes Road intersection to determine if the expected operations can be improved.
Conclusions
A single-lane roundabout is expected to provide the best traffic operations for the Line Avenue/Twin Lakes
Road intersection. A roundabout would improve safety by eliminating the opportunity for head-on or ‘T-
bone’ crashes at the intersection. The roundabout would also provide a calming effect on traffic, slowing
speeds through the intersection.
Based upon this result, a roundabout is recommended for construction at the intersection in conjunction
with the disconnect of Line Avenue between the 3rd Street and 5th Street intersections. A formal
justification report for the roundabout may be necessary for documentation with the County and/or the
State Aid Office of the Minnesota Department of Transportation.
If the roundabout is not able to be constructed in conjunction with the disconnect, all-way stop control
may be appropriate as a short-term solution until the roundabout could be built. A formal justification
report may be necessary to document this decision. In addition, the change from side-street stop to all-
way stop requires notification to drivers of the change. This often occurs in the form of orange warning
signs, red flags, and/or changeable message signs on the mainline to warn of the traffic control change.

Mitigation Options
The existing Line Avenue/Twin Lakes Road intersection provides the following geometry:
One left turn lane, one thru lane, one right turn lane for the northbound approach
One left turn/thru lane and one right turn lane for the southbound approach
One lane for all movements for the eastbound and westbound approaches
To improve operations, the following mitigation options were considered:
1. Additional approach lanes with a change in traffic control, which can increase safety and capacity
by allowing more traffic through the intersection
2. All-way stop control, which can be implemented easily and provide more opportunity for side
street movements through the intersection
3. Single-lane roundabout control, which significantly improves safety, provides a calming effect by
slowing traffic, and can provide an increase in capacity
Results
An intersection capacity analysis was conducted for the existing intersections per the Highway Capacity
Manual, 2010. Intersections are assigned a “Level of Service” letter grade for the peak hour of traffic based
on the number of lanes at the intersection, traffic volumes, and traffic control. Level of Service A (LOS A)
represents light traffic flow (free flow conditions) while LOS F represents heavy traffic flow (over capacity
conditions). LOS D is considered acceptable at intersections. Individual movements are also assigned LOS
grades. At busy intersections, one or more individual movements may operate at a lower LOS when the
overall intersection is operating acceptably at LOS C or D.
The intersection was analyzed during the a.m. and p.m. peak hours for the following Scenarios:
Existing conditions
Existing geometry with Line Avenue disconnected between 3rd Street and 5th Street
Two-Way stop control with additional approach lanes
All-Way stop control with existing approach lanes
Single-lane roundabout control
With the exception of the existing conditions, all scenarios were analyzed with the forecasted volumes
assuming Line Avenue is disconnected between 3rd Street and 5th Street. A summary of the LOS results for
these scenarios is shown in Table 1. The LOS calculations were completed with the VISTROTM software
package, which uses the methodology detailed in the Highway Capacity Manual 2010. The full LOS
calculations are attached to this memorandum.
